The goal is to find “Los Tres B’s” (The Three B’s): bueno, bonito y barato (good, nice and cheap). Repeat that to yourself—let it become your new mercado mantra. WebHow do you say “cheap” in Spanish? The adjective ‘cheap’ is ‘barato/a,’ meaning ‘inexpensive.’ If you want to say ‘petty, miserable, paltry,’ use ‘mezquino/a.’ The expression for ‘tasteless, cheap-looking’ is ‘de mal gusto.’ If you want to … sims 4 farm house
